Kuklov (Hungarian: Kukló) is a village and municipality in Senica District in the Trnava Region of western Slovakia.

In historical records the village was first mentioned in 1394.
The municipality lies at an altitude of 162 metres and covers an area of 18.704 km². It has a population of about 790 people.
